Layer 2 Scaling Actually Matters?
Arbitrum (ARB) isn't just another Layer 2. It’s a pragmatic solution to Ethereum's biggest headache: scalability. We’re all too familiar with how insane gas fees on Ethereum can get, turning even the most basic transactions into unaffordable prospects. Think of it like this: Ethereum is a bustling city center, congested and expensive to navigate. Arbitrum builds a high-speed rail system over the city. With this innovation, we’re relieving congestion and saving travelers over 90% in travel time and cost on average.
With over $2.9 billion locked in its DeFi ecosystem, Arbitrum is the leader in the Ethereum Layer-2 race. This isn’t merely theoretical—real value is currently being used for staking, lending, and stablecoin swaps. That's not just speculation, it's utility. And its Ethereum compatibility is a massive appeal to developers. It's easy to migrate existing apps. No need to rewrite everything from scratch.

Unlocking GPU Power for the Masses
Render (RNDR) tackles a completely different problem: the ever-growing demand for GPU computing power. Imagine creating a virtual world using AI, 3D rendering and video game creation technology. It all requires massive processing capabilities. Historically, this has resulted in expensive, front-loaded investments in hardware. What if you didn’t have to—what if you could just rent all that GPU firepower, whenever you need it? That's Render's vision.
It’s sort of like Airbnb, but for GPUs. Anyone can join its decentralized GPU network and rent out their unused processing power. This is a major revolution for creative teams and anyone who is currently creating with the help of AI. It’s a clever, budget-friendly solution to purchasing high-end assets. With AI video exploding, Render’s need is only set to boom.
Render’s early relationship with Nvidia is especially notable. More than anything, it provides credibility and gives them a leg up on the competition. It reminds me of the early days of the internet. Web3 Gaming Without the Gas Fees
Immutable (IMX) is focused on gaming. Specifically, making Web3 gaming a reality. The largest hurdle to realize for most gamers? Gas fees. Now, imagine that you had to pay a USD fee every time you wanted to trade an in-game item back and forth. It's absurd! Immutable addresses this issue with its gas-free NFT minting system.
This is huge for developers. It clears away a big hurdle and lets them get back to the business of developing new, interesting and enjoyable games. Immutable is already the home to more than 50 active titles and the world’s most active NFT network by daily transactions. That tells you something. People are playing, and they're trading. Altcoin | Focus | Key Benefit | Potential Impact |
---|---|---|---|
Arbitrum | Layer 2 Scaling | Low transaction fees, high throughput | Makes DeFi more accessible and affordable |
Render | Decentralized GPU Network | Cost-effective access to GPU power | Democratizes access to AI and 3D rendering |
Immutable | Web3 Gaming Platform | Gas-free NFT minting | Unlocks new levels of ownership and engagement in games |
